From KVOA Tuscon:
Located about 50 miles Southeastof Tucson, Sonoita and Elgin are home to six wineries: Callaghan Vineyards, Canelo Hills Vineyard and Winery, Dos Cabezas WineWorks, Rancho Rossa Vineyards, Sonoita Vineyards and The Village of Elgin Winery.
Each features its own tasting room, and some offer tours of their vineyards and facilities.
There are several other wineries in southern Arizona, including Charron Vineyards in Vail and Coronado Vineyards in Willcox.
They are all part of a larger network. Statewide, 26 bonded wineries and 38 vineyards have more than 4,000 acres of grapes under cultivation, according to the Arizona Wine Growers Association.
The Arizona wine industry is pleased to see growth in recent years. According to the article it rose from $18 million to about $36 million last year and visitation to wineries has increased as well.
